Mountain Brook Wow! House: Original Mountain Brook Estates Home
One of the original Mountain Brook Estates homes, this $5 million 1920s estate is classic inside and out.
MOUNTAIN BROOK, AL - Sitting on a two-acre lot, this original Mountain Brook Estates home is a rare buying opportunity. Listed at just under $5 million, this 1928 home was originally designed by David Willdin for Willis Rushton, the widow of Franklin Rushton.

- Features: The original beauty of this historic home has been lovingly maintained throughout the years, while recent extensive renovations provide every modern amenity you can expect for luxurious living. The home has four bedrooms and six and a half bathrooms in the main house plus a guesthouse with a bedroom and full bathroom adjoining the three-car garage, which has been converted into a workout studio, also offering an additional half bathroom. Outside, the multi-generational professional landscaping creates a quiet haven with a natural sense of place.
